Silk Pillowcases: Your Low-Key Hair Hack

Not into wrapping your hair every night? Silk pillowcases are the lazy girl’s luxury. You literally just go to sleep—no extra steps. The smooth texture of silk means less friction on your strands, which equals less breakage, less frizz, and more retained moisture (aka soft, healthy hair). Bonus points: your skin benefits too. No more waking up with creased cheeks and sleep lines. Your face and hair both get to live their best life.

Satin Bonnets: The Real MVP of Hair Protection

Now if you’re rocking braids, a silk press, a twist-out, or just care deeply about your edges, a bonnet might be the better fit. Think of it as a night guard for your hair—keeping everything in place, reducing friction, and locking in moisture while you sleep. Satin bonnets (or silk if you’re feeling fancy) are gentle on your strands and come in enough prints and colors to match your personality. Whether you want classy, cute, or bold—you can slay in your sleep.

So… Which One Do You Actually Need?

Hair type matters. If your hair tangles easily or you’re trying to preserve a style, a bonnet will keep your look intact and your strands in check. If your hair is more low-maintenance or you just want a backup for nights you “forget” to wrap it, a silk pillowcase has your back (and sides, and edges).

Your routine matters. Love a full nighttime routine with oils, butters, and good intentions? Grab that bonnet, queen. Want to flop into bed with zero effort and still protect your hair? Pillowcase it is.

Your vibe matters. Want to feel cute even while half-asleep? Bonnets come in every color and vibe under the moon. Prefer something that blends into your neutral bedding and doesn’t ruin your aesthetic? Hello, silk pillowcase.
